Yurt campgrounds are certain to please even the pickiest of campers, and with so many options, you can easily plan a trip that suits your style, as well as your timeline. With ample space to unwind, yurt campsites are popular throughout Pennsylvania’s state parks, and many come with modern upgrades and cozy interiors—think wooden floors, spacious living rooms, and bunk beds that will leave you reminiscing about summer camp. Yurts are also great for quick Keystone State Park getaways from Pittsburgh and romantic glamping weekends alike. No matter where you are in the state, from your yurt, you can spend your camping trip fishing, hiking, and enjoying quality time with your campmates. Amenities range from fire pits and camp stoves to wifi, with many keeping campers comfortable even in the cooler months. In fact, plenty of Pennsylvania parks, including Tuscarora State Park, remain open year-round and look just as spectacular in snow as they do in the sun.
